Registers¶
The living records. Registers are the evidence that governance is operating rather than merely documented — and the first thing a regulator asks for.
| Template | Status | Purpose |
|---|---|---|
| Data Asset Register | Ready | The catalogue of what data you hold, who owns it, how sensitive it is, and where it lives. Almost every other governance control depends on it. |
| AI System Inventory | Ready | The single list of every AI system you build, buy, or have embedded in something you already licence. It is the foundation of AI Act compliance: every… |
| Risk Register | Ready | The live record of data and AI risks: what could go wrong, how likely and how bad, what you are doing about it, and who owns it. |
| Issue & Incident Log | Ready | The record of what went wrong, what you did, and what changed as a result. It is both a management tool and the evidence base for serious-incident… |
| Processing & DPIA Log | Ready | The record of personal data processing activities and the impact assessments that cover them — the point where AI governance meets data protection law. |
